const assert = require('assert')
const fs = require('fs')
const ktbl = require('../index.js')
// Query a single working step
ktbl.procedure({
procedureGroupId: '3',
procedureId: '290',
machCombinationId: '2493',
size: '1',
resistance: 'leicht',
distance: '1',
amount: '130.0',
workingWidth: '4.0',
})
.then(result => {
// fs.writeFileSync('test/results/procedure.json', JSON.stringify(result), 'utf-8')
const comparison = JSON.parse(fs.readFileSync('test/results/procedure.json','utf-8'))
assert.deepStrictEqual(comparison, result)
})
.catch(err => {
fs.writeFileSync('procedureErr.json', JSON.stringify(err),'utf8')
})
// Query crop procedures
ktbl.cropProcedures({
'crop': 'Ackergras - Anwelksilage',
'type': 'konventionell/integriert',
'system': 'Ballen'
})
.then(result => {
//fs.writeFileSync('test/results/cropProcedures.json', JSON.stringify(result), 'utf-8')
const comparison = JSON.parse(fs.readFileSync('test/results/cropProcedures.json','utf-8'))
assert.deepStrictEqual(comparison, result)
})
.catch(err => {
fs.writeFileSync('cropProcedureErr.json', JSON.stringify(err),'utf8')
})
